Output 24b403f6c39ba9a3a9f03945d3006ae14c0682f0da76720918d7123bb4c94af1:0

value
2659031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 656da633747a7a36b98a955acc27d2697ee58bb2 OP_EQUAL
address
3AwKXUoa5QySXMuzAmRfabq6xN5XMNw2GM
transaction
24b403f6c39ba9a3a9f03945d3006ae14c0682f0da76720918d7123bb4c94af1
spent
true